Subject: ChipGate reader 2.1 out

Welcome, new folks. ChipGate 2.1, our marathon timing-chip reader firmware, is now in the release channel. It fixes the mat-crossing debounce bug seen at the Fenholm race. Flash only units returned from the field, and verify the checksum first. Reference the build token below when reporting issues.

trace token, fafog-kageg: htk4_98e6

// RENDER_BATCH_SIZE — why this number?
//
// Welcome aboard. The Quillmark template engine used to flush after every
// partial, which hammered the string allocator and made dashboard pages
// render in ~900ms. Batching 64 partials per flush cut that to ~140ms in
// the Harrowgate benchmarks. Don't bump this past 128: memory spikes and
// the gains flatten out. If you change it, rerun the perf suite and note
// the results. The benchmark baseline build is recorded below.

pipeline stamp: htk31_32b48784f8c83c96a621312a3a842c7

Reviewers should note that it intentionally skips vendored components and anything flagged `@no-i18n`, so a missing key is usually a tagging issue rather than a parser bug. Changes to the tokenizer regexes require a second approval, since a bad pattern once dropped half the Verlano storefront's German strings. All questions about extraction rules, exclusion lists, or the nightly sync job should go to the current owner, named below.

named custodian: Brivan Eliath Quenox Frador

Resolution for internal Fernwick services intermittently fails because the sidecar resolver caches NXDOMAIN responses longer than our churn rate tolerates. We worked around it by pointing services at the Tollgate resolver pool and lowering negative-cache TTLs. Future maintainers should keep that override in place until the sidecar is replaced. The Tollgate pool requires client authentication, and the next line sets its shared secret.

vault entry, kafog-yahop: COURIER_KEY8=0faa53ae